The helmet is crafted after a 13th-century original. Helmets of this type were worn in large numbers throughout Europe between the 13th and 16th centuries. The secret was most commonly worn beneath the great helm, which was removed during duels. In this way the head remained protected, the wearer retained a full field of view, and his breathing was not hampered.
The secret is constructed from 2 mm thick steel. The three parts are screwed together. Holes have been applied to the side and the back, permitting the attachment of an aventail. The interior features a leather inlay, and the helmet may be fastened with a chin strap.
